Album Notes

The music of Rich O'Reilly is difficult to place in a particular genre under the Singer Song Writer title. It tends to have a classic rock sound yet, weaving in and out of several other genres.

Rich first picked up the bass at the age 13. By the time he was 17, he was playing in the local club scene in the Boston area. He continued to play the New England scene for the next 25 years as a band member and in a freelance bassist’s role.

Through that period, he has had the opportunity to play with many of the top rock, blues and jazz bands in the area. With those bands he has opened for many national acts at clubs such as, The House Of Blues in Cambridge, MA and The Last Call Saloon in Providence, RI. This also opened the door for him to headline at many these clubs.

In 2003, Rich took a break from years of the club scene to pursue his own writing ambitions. During this period, he fine tuned his acoustic guitar playing and set up his home studio.
He has since written, recorded and produced 3 CDs of his own material from this studio. Most recently, Personal Dare has been released.

In addition to writing his own material, Rich still accepts freelance bass work and is involved with a few Jazz acts in the Boston/Providence area.
